Форум: "Базы";
Текущий архив: 2003.12.26;
Скачать: [xml.tar.bz2];
ВнизTADOQuery при выполнении INSERT... методом ExecSQL глючит?? Найти похожие ветки
← →
НАВИЧЕК (2003-12-02 12:24) [0]Использую D6,MSSQL2000, для доступак нему беру TADOQuery
заполняю свойство SQL запрос:
SET DATEFORMAT dmy
NSERT INTO sb_tickets (sale_date_time) VALUES ("25.11.03 17:24")
и пытаюсь его выполнить:
if DM.qSQL.Active then DM.qSQL.Close;
try
DM.qSQL.ExecSQL;
Res:= DM.qSQL.RowsAffected;
except
end;
все выполняется, на сервер все пишется корректно. только вот Res всегда = -1 (т.е. ошибка при выполнении запроса)
Если запрос прошел то -1, если запрос не прошел (поле уникальное)все равно -1.... че за хрень мож кто сталкивался.
← →
Fay (2003-12-02 15:14) [1]Ку?
set nocount on
insert into sb_tickets (sale_date_time) VALUES ("20031125 17:24:00.000")
select @@rowcount as [Row_Count]
.............................
DM.qSQL.Open;
Res := DM.qSQL.Fields[0].AsInteger;
Страницы: 1 вся ветка
Форум: "Базы";
Текущий архив: 2003.12.26;
Скачать: [xml.tar.bz2];
Память: 0.44 MB
Время: 0.007 c